The Schneider Electric CF2316GETBMB is engineered specifically for demanding applications in material handling, packaging, and textile machinery. This circuit breaker is designed to enhance operational efficiency and reliability in industrial environments, where equipment uptime is critical.
In material handling systems, the CF2316GETBMB provides robust protection against overloads and short circuits, ensuring that machinery operates within safe parameters. Its precise trip characteristics allow for tailored protection settings, which can be crucial in applications where varying loads are common. This adaptability minimizes the risk of equipment damage and reduces maintenance costs over time.
For packaging machinery, the CF2316GETBMB's compact design and high performance ensure that it can be easily integrated into existing systems without compromising space or functionality. Its ability to handle high inrush currents makes it ideal for applications with motors that require significant starting power, thereby improving overall system reliability and reducing the likelihood of operational interruptions.
In textile manufacturing, where machinery operates under continuous load conditions, the CF2316GETBMB contributes to enhanced safety and operational continuity. Its thermal-magnetic trip mechanism provides reliable protection, allowing engineers to focus on optimizing production processes rather than worrying about electrical failures.
